Abstract
Q-balls arise in particle theories with U(1) global symmetry. The coupling of the corresponding scalar field to fermions leads to Q-ball evaporation. In this paper we consider the oposite problem, the case where a Q-ball absorbs particles to grow. In particular we shall use the exact quantum mechanical description of fermions interacting with a Q-ball to solve the problem. Results show that Q-ball condensation can be another mechanism for Q-ball creation.
